      If you keep them to close together you might give him free splash, so hitting 5 stacks with only one shot, multiplying his damage.

      Also if he is really good, he likely has Specs anyway to surveill your troops.

      Hit and Run and 60 s reload are old features, that already existed in Supremacy 1914 and likely in Call of War too.
      The first at least is considered basic knowledge in alliance circles.

      Also putting all your ranged units into one pure stack, is quite a bad idea, in case you get hit yourself.

      And I have to add, Hit and Run does not always work anymore, devs boosted reaction time of AI, sometimes it shoots immediately back.
